🔑 Key Concepts

Hybrid Architecture

  • On-Chain: Escrow, settlement (trustless)
  • Off-Chain: User data, search, notifications (fast UX)
  • Sync: Event indexer keeps database updated

Oracle Network

  • 5 independent nodes
  • 3 of 5 consensus threshold
  • Fetches results from external APIs
  • Cryptographic signature verification

Transaction Flow

User Action
  ↓
Gas Estimate Display
  ↓
MetaMask Signature (production)
  ↓
Transaction Submitted
  ↓
Confirmation Modal
  ↓
Event Indexer Sync
  ↓
UI Update

🎯 Quick Commands Reference

# Deploy and test
./test-docker.sh

# Start services
docker compose up -d

# View logs
docker compose logs -f

# Stop services
docker compose down

# Reset everything
docker compose down -v

# Rebuild
docker compose build --no-cache

# Shell access
docker compose exec backend bash
docker compose exec frontend sh

# Verify files
./verify-integration.sh

# E2E tests
node test-e2e.js
